Mechanical Failure
Trains are huge machines that need constant support from control rooms and towers. Therefore, it is not a surprise that minor mechanical failures like loose screws or defective rail signals are the main cause of train accidents.
The conductors are taught to be on the lookout for signs of damaged or broken railroad tracks and to apply emergency brakes when they encounter an obstacle. In some instances they are unable to spot obstacles that aren't visible from the driver's seat like a puddle, or an opening between two rails. If a conductor is unable to notice these hazards and a derailment leads to injuries or deaths, then that individual or their employer could be held accountable for negligence.
The railway companies responsible for the maintenance and inspection of their equipment and tracks could also be responsible for train derailments that occur because of inattention on their part. Lack of maintenance can cause the railway track to expand and contract, causing it over time to be damaged or warped. When this occurs it is common for a train to encounter and collide with obstacles on the railway. In some instances this could cause the train to veer.

Defective Equipment
Defective equipment can cause a train to derail in some cases. A wheel bearing that is damaged or malfunctioning could cause a railcar to derrail. Bearings are designed to support the train's weight as well as the forces generated during movement. Faulty tracks
Train derailments can be extremely dangerous although they aren't as often as car accidents. If a train is thrown off the tracks, it can cause catastrophic injuries and death for passengers. Derailments can expose people harmful chemicals and lead to long-term health issues if a train is transporting them.
The number of victims in a single train crash usually exceeds the number injured in a typical auto accident. It is crucial to work with a train derailment lawyer as soon as you can after an accident to determine what went wrong and who should be held liable for the incident.
There are a variety of factors that can contribute to an accident involving a train, such as:
Track defects: If there is an issue with the condition of the tracks like broken rails, or loose ties, they could cause the train to slide off. Regular inspections and maintenance can help avoid these kinds of issues.
Equipment failure: Mechanical problems with the train's wheels or bearings could lead to a derailment. This is why it's essential for a train company to perform regular maintenance and inspections of its trains.
Human error: Train engineers and other employees of railways could make mistakes that could lead to an accident that causes a derailment.
